WebAug 31, 2024 · How to sharpen lawnmower blades with a Dremel, step by step: Get the needed tools. Disconnect the spark plug and inspect the existing set of blades. Remove the center nut of the blade carefully and clamp it. Sharpen the Blade with a Dremel. Smoothen the edges and finish the blade. Balance the blade and fix it back.

With an axe sharpening file, it took about 10 minutes total to sharpen 4 edges to a little past steak knife sharp. flume idahoWebJun 28, 2013 · Since reel lawn mower blades work like scissors; they’re not necessarily as sharp as they are exact. The edge of the blade needs to be true and close to the bed knife. That’s what lapping does. To lap your blades you need two things; lapping compound, an abrasive, and a way to turn your blades. flume houston
